Type
ORACLE
Validation date
2025-05-16 16:19: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.9694e-4,
    "usd": 2.1937e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000124554DB0AE517BD42683D6906EA789C325C5788289B0BB989C791233BCD7886C

Previous signature

864981B2457BC3623D4B820392D449245463D97CBBD8B05DC71A98DC85C9EFE874FE38FB7013120FCBF1D728A646C5C6EB4829EBA9A4A3B60335D0C8AD374F02

Origin signature

304502200454FD6F1534BDD326DF011F1DAD5DDD9283A2162FD7151F4571F18876F487A1022100A2809C9C1E0A07049ABFA9A4EF5C4AA38C55B102203C8F06BE76D3A195DCA4BE

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00C99C06DA4B3747126620B95D6C9E8516137951566B103A9586AE2BF40DD30DEC

Coordinator signature

F22605044B431F5AE3AC34FF3DCC348770AFE10A646955986B1EC88AEDA9CB6FB6E4242B503930139440C3F7844DBCCCD1161198CC295D886D5EACF7EA779906

Validator #1 public key

0001C1C01D374F5BC9870B0C7731398E370A8EF2401053E869209DEDAE7A34E3DED3

Validator #1 signature

65E33C491E1178476D7DF3BFBF8F9BB67644ECB0981AC6986E7753A725A033CE8CFE76EBC69152BA04C510FA7047715B4F4D247CB9AAE2ABDC6A031937FBEC09

Validator #2 public key

0001A9AB604825D028C2EF81E8D7F6CCF6EFEDD2D1B72741DA098152D8B89652FD3F

Validator #2 signature

66847C6566178384C14558D84518E4E0265AC4DA72FE249541541F3C56A0D3CE55AD0E17689FF90DA295879E5703164F99CA9228D1EB657AABE744AE9E72A000